Transaction 84f6553f1783da971f67982b4a61bcd83a350549b66a57cffb6b023c2fc4a6d1
1 Input
1 Output
-
84f6553f1783da971f67982b4a61bcd83a350549b66a57cffb6b023c2fc4a6d1:0
- value
- 1640232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 124809d81e4f217933b4c0298aa2cd9e2f055ccf OP_EQUAL
- address
- 33MgPKJ4BMnegSz2HW74RQE3LAJFMngvYq